Hi all in Rome are there public restrooms available that are wheelchair accessible? Thank you
Know that most bathrooms in the historic center are nit wheelchair accessible. Many are up at least a few stairs. And many others are down a full flight of stairs. I’ve been surprised to find bathrooms in the basement of businesses that have a handicap sign and grab bars. Can the wheelchair user do any stairs?
Bathrooms in nicer hotels are often accessible.

Many coffee bars have bathrooms that only have a step or two. We have been pleasantly impressed by hiw many bar managers/staff are very understanding and helpfuk.every neighborhood in Rome has many coffee shops or bars.
Have you checked with where you’ll be lodging about their accessibility? Many hotel elevators are up several stadirs.
